Hickey and Stott crowned champions at U23 European Championships as GB Boxers return home with nine medals

By 21st October 2024News

GB BOXING’s men and women have returned from the U23 European Championships in Sofia, Bulgaria, with nine medals, including light-welterweight Sacha Hickey and cruiserweight Teagn Stott who both won gold to be crowned champions of their respective contests.

The other medals were won by English trio Lauren Mackie (54kg), Patris Mughalzai (63.5kg) and Isaac Okoh (92kg) as well as Scotland’s Aaron Cullen (54kg) who all earned silver medals whilst Sameenah Toussaint (60kg), Jack Dryden (60kg) and Dione Burman (66kg) took bronze.

Sacha Hickey was the first of the two newly crowned champions to win gold in Sofia, as she confidently defeated Serbia’s Kristina Kuluhova 5-0 in the women’s welterweight final.

On her way to clinching top spot on the podium, the 21-year-old got the better of Ukraine’s Yuliia Filipova and Turkiye’s Esmanur Lok in equally convincing unanimous fashion.

The gold medal in Bulgaria is the second Hickey has won in the space of a month having also earned top spot at the Dacal World Cup in September.

The same can be said for the second and final gold medallist of the U23 European Championships as Teagn Stott also came into the competition off the back of a gold medal at the Dacal.

On this occasion, the cruiserweight clinched his gold medal with a classy display to outpoint Ukraine’s Ashot Kocharian unanimously.

On his way to be being crowned champion in Sofia, Stott also defeated Georgia’s Giorgii Gutsaev and Azerbaijan’s Seyid Seyidov as well as the host nation’s Makita Gorbatenko in what was one of the bouts of the tournament.

Fellow GB Boxers Patris Mughalzai and Aaron Cullen as well as Lauren Mackie and Isaac Okoh were also in action on finals day.

The pair won three and four bouts respectively on their way to their final bouts, with both having to settle for silver following 4:1 split decision.

It was a similar story for Mackie and Okoh who whilst unanimously beaten in the final, secured multiple victories on their way to achieving a major medal on the European stage.

Elsewhere across the home nations, three other boxers picked up medals with Scottish duo Caitlin Kelly (70kg) and Allan Perrie (75kg) as well as England’s Leo Wood (57kg) all earning bronze.
